Fleming Opens South Brunswick Distribution Center

    DALLAS, Sept. 19 /PRNewswire/ -- Fleming (NYSE: FLM) announced today the
successful opening and initiation of service from its newest distribution
center in South Brunswick, New Jersey.  This 540,000 square foot facility,
located at exit 8A of the New Jersey Turnpike, is ideally suited to serve
stores up and down the I-95 corridor.
    "Our new South Brunswick facility is state-of-the-art all the way," said
Bill Merrigan, Senior Vice President, Logistics for Fleming.  "With a total of
114 doors -- 57 on each side of the warehouse -- this warehouse is optimally
planned for speed, productivity, and efficiency.  Warehoused inventory is set
up in family groups to minimize slotting and picking time, and forklift
routing is controlled by radio frequency communications systems.  It has also
been set up to handle flow-through operations, a tremendous efficiency-builder
in our business."
    The warehouse is initially slated to handle $600 million per year in
annual dry grocery volume.  Long-term, the warehouse has an engineered
capacity of more than two times that volume, allowing for growth in the
current business as well as the addition of new customers.  Adjacent
facilities and parcels allow for continued future growth and the addition of
other categories, such as frozen foods and produce.

    Fleming is the industry leader in distribution and has a growing presence
in value retailing.  Fleming's primary business is buying and selling
merchandise.  The company serves approximately 3,000 supermarkets including
more than 700 North American stores of global supermarketer IGA and other
regional banners, 6,800 convenience stores and more than 2,000 supercenters,
discount, limited assortment, drug, specialty, and other businesses across the
